How Fast are 125Cc Pit Bikes?

Most 125cc dirt bikes have a top speed of about 55 mph. This speed is enough for children and young adults to have fun, but heavy riders will be able to push their bikes up to the 60 mph mark. This type of pit bike is available for under $3000, but more expensive models can cost up to $10,000.

Pit bikes have a front and rear suspension. Lower-priced models will usually have basic suspension that is not adjustable. For maximum performance, invest in high-quality suspension. Look for inverted front forks and adjustable compression and rebound. Some models will also have a rear linkage system that will optimize the progression ratio.

How Can I Increase My Bike Speed?

If you’re looking for a quick boost to your pit bike’s top speed, you should consider upgrading to a larger front sprocket and a smaller rear sprocket. This combination will increase top speed through all gears, without sacrificing low-end torque acceleration. You can usually find different sizes of sprockets for different bikes on eBay. For example, a 16-tooth front sprocket coupled with a 37-tooth rear sprocket is a good starting point.
